A point is given in the distance-angle system. What would it be called, approximately, in the grid system? (Hint: Use a protractor and a centimetre ruler to draw the triangle suggested by the angle and distance. Measure the sides of the triangle.)

a.2,50°,b.1.5,−70°,c.3,90°,d.1,120°

Short Answer

Expert verified

Given points in distance-angle system be called as

a.1.28,1.58,b.0.51,−1.41,c.0,3,d.−0.5,0.86

Step by step solution

01

Part a. Step 1. Plot the point.

Plot the point2,50° on grid system as 2 cm from origin at an angle of50° anticlockwise.

02

Part a. Step 2. Find grid system point.

Usea protractor and a centimetre ruler todraw the triangle as shown in the figure thenmeasure the sides of triangle.

x=1.28cmy=1.58cm

03

Part a. Step 3. Write given point in grid system.

Conversion of point from distance-angle system to grid system is x,y

Thus,2,50°=1.28,1.58

04

Part b. Step 1. Plot the point.

Plot the point1.5,−70° on grid system as1.5cm from origin at an angle of70° clockwise.

05

Part b. Step 2. Find grid system point.

Usea protractor and a centimetre ruler todraw the triangle as shown in the figure thenmeasure the sides of triangle.

x=0.51cmy=−1.41cm

06

Part b. Step 3. Write given point in grid system.

Conversion of point from distance-angle system to grid system is x,y

Thus,1.5,−70°=0.51,−1.41

07

Part c. Step 1. Plot the point.

Plot the point3,90° on grid system as 3 cm from origin at an angle of90° anticlockwise.

08

Part c. Step 2. Find grid system point.

Usea protractor and a centimetre ruler todraw the triangle as shown in the figure thenmeasure the sides of triangle.

x=0cmy=3cm

09

Part c. Step 3. Write given point in grid system.

Conversion of point from distance-angle system to grid system is x,y

Thus,3,90°=0,3

10

Part d. Step 1. Plot the point.

Plot the point1,120° on grid system as 1 cm from origin at an angle of120° anticlockwise.

11

Part d. Step 2. Find grid system of point.

Usea protractor and a centimetre ruler todraw the triangle as shown in the figure thenmeasure the sides of triangle.

x=−0.5cmy=0.86cm

12

Part d. Step 3. Write given point in grid system.

Conversion of point from distance-angle system to grid system isx,y
